Link to transcription, outline and summary: https://docs.google.com/document/d/1RZU4jzzQZac_NtXMzvCThPbgRcmW0ylT-tLHrK6Tz0I/edit?usp=sharing Sermon Summary: “Sad But Lost” by Alton Bailey (October 5, 2025) Caution! Generated by AI, There may be errors. In this sobering message, Alton Bailey laments the billions who will be eternally lost, echoing Jesus' warning in Matthew 7:13-14: The broad way to destruction is crowded and easy, while the narrow gate to life is difficult and found by few. Drawing on global stats (~8 billion people, only 32% claim Christ; Bible Belt like Alabama at 89% belief), he challenges religious complacency—many want heaven on their terms, not God's. Using 1 Timothy 3:15, Bailey stresses God's house (the church) demands conduct by His rules, like guests in a home. He illustrates Bible studies where agreements on God, Jesus, the Holy Spirit, and Scripture quickly diverge: Most ignore baptism (Mark 16:16), faith without works (James 2:24), true repentance (2 Cor. 7:10), and weekly Lord's Supper (Acts 20:7), favoring easy paths like the sinner's prayer or Christmas over biblical mandates. The broad way tempts with self-direction (Prov. 14:12; Jer. 10:23; Judges 21:25), Satan's blinding (2 Cor. 4:3-4), emotional drifts (Heb. 2:1, Niagara Falls analogy), faulty consciences (Acts 2:37-38), and unverified preachers (James 3:1; 2 Cor. 11:14-15). Yet, the narrow gate demands searching the Word like a home contract—jot and tittle—for the soul's sake. Bailey concludes with Revelation 2:10: Endure persecution faithfully unto death for the crown of life; overcomers escape the second death. No sin enters heaven—be washed in Christ's blood now.
